Visit Larcay: Highlights and Tourist Information

Location: Larcay is situated in the Indre-et-Loire department (Loire Valley region) in the eastern-center of France at 7 km from Tours, the department capital. (General information: Larcay is 202 km from Paris and 406 km from the port at Calais).

Note: The photo above was taken in Tours at 7 km from Larcay

Popular places to visit near Larcay: these include Tours at 7 km and Chateau d'Amboise at 16 km.

Cloisters of la Psalette is a listed 'national monument' at 7km and Le jardin des Prébendes d'Oé is a listed 'remarkable garden' at 7km. For more places to visit nearby and local tourist attractions see the map and listings below.

Tourist classifications for Larcay: Village in bloom (ville fleurie) 1*;

Tourist attractions nearby

Below we show places with official tourist classifications and other places of interest to visit nearby that should provide inspiration if you are visiting Larcay and wondering what to do next!

  1. 'Remarkable gardens': Le jardin des Prébendes d'Oé (7km) : Les jardins du prieuré de Saint-Cosme (9km) : Parc et jardins du château de Valmer (12km) : Les jardins du château de Villandry (20km) : Parc et jardins du château de Chenonceau (22km) : Les jardins de la Chatonnière (26km) : Domaine régional de Chaumont-sur-Loire (33km) : Jardin du domaine de Sasnières (41km) : Jardins du château de Poncé (45km) : Les jardins du château du Rivau (46km) :
  2. National Monuments: Cloisters of la Psalette (7km) : Chateau d'Azay-le-Rideau (27km) : Fougeres-sur-Bievre Chateau (43km) :
  3. Beautiful Villages: Crissay-sur-Manse (33km) : Montresor (40km) : Lavardin (42km) :
  4. Town / village in bloom 4*: Saint-Cyr-sur-Loire (9km) :
  5. Towns of Art and History: Tours (7km) : Amboise (16km) : Loches (33km) : Chinon (45km) : Blois (48km) :
